Rotten potatoes and onions found in 77% of the supermarkets

The Consumer Council of Fiji has found rotten, mouldy and sliced potatoes and onions in 77 percent of supermarkets surveyed in the greater Suva area this morning.

The surveillance was driven by the Council’s current beefed up market surveillance as well as complaints raised by concerned consumers.

Chief Executive Officer Seema Shandil says supermarkets were issued with warning letters and the Council will be submitting a report of this surveillance to the Food Safety Unit of the Ministry of Health.

Shandil says they will also submit a report to the relevant municipal councils for stringent action to be taken against these supermarkets.

She says this practice by supermarkets is unacceptable especially when there is a high demand for potatoes and onions during the Diwali season.
